The main difference between an Internship Shopify Software Engineer and a Shopify Software Engineer is experience level and employment status. Internships are designed for students or recent graduates gaining initial industry exposure, while full-time Shopify Software Engineers have more experience and responsibilities. Internships often serve as a pathway to full-time roles within Shopify or similar companies.

Job description

Sleep Country Canada is looking for a Technical Lead, Digital Platforms to play a critical role in end-to-end technical ownership of digital systems, ensuring they are reliable, scalable, and aligned with business and architectural goals. This role provides technical leadership across initiatives, drives standardization and efficiency through modern development practices, and partners with cross-functional teams to deliver integrated, high-performing solutions that support strong data insights and an enhanced customer experience.

In this current open role you will:

  • Own end-to-end technical design and architecture for digital platforms, including eCommerce, frontend, and integration layers.     
  • Define and oversee integration design between digital platforms and backend systems (APIs, order systems, inventory, payment services).
  • Ensure digital platforms are scalable, stable, and aligned with technical standards and best practices.
  • Provide technical direction and guidance to digital development teams and external vendors.
  • Validate technical feasibility, identify risks, and define mitigation strategies during planning and delivery.
  • Collaborate with Delivery Managers and Product Owners to align technical design with delivery timelines and business requirements.
  • Evaluate and introduce modern development practices and technologies, including AI-enabled solutions, to improve platform capability, delivery efficiency, and customer experience 

The Qualifications and experience we like to see: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Engineering or related field.
  • 6 -8 years experience in software engineering, digital platform development, or technical leadership roles. 
  • Strong experience with digital platforms (eCommerce systems such as BigCommerce, Shopify or similar) 
  • Experience designing and supporting API-driven integrations 
  • Understanding of frontend and backend application architecture 
  • Experience with web technologies (e.g., JavaScript frameworks, REST APIs) 
  • Experience working with cloud platforms (Azure, GCP, or similar) 
  •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ills in production environments 
  • Ability to guide and influence development teams without direct authority 
  • Experience working with external vendors and delivery partners 
  • Strong communication skills with ability to translate techn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ders 
  • Experience working in complex, multi-system environments
  • The knowledge of English is required for this specific position as the incumbent will interact on a consistent and regular basis with English-speaking stakeholders located outside of Quebec.
